Any opportunity to put a smaller diameter wheel on your car to save on tires?

I took my '15 Sienna from 18" to 17" (the only OEM sizes), '13 ES300h from 17" to 16" (because the Avalon platform on which it is based supported 16"), '06 Beetle down from 18" to 15" (because the ancient Golf platform on which it was build had supported 15"). As a bonus, you will likely get marginal improvements in mileage. Just stop trying to pull those Fast & Furious corners...
